Summary: SLP(Crl) No. 2972/2000 - Bijendra Prasad Yadav v. C.B.I., Patna On 14/07/2003, the Supreme Court disposed of the special leave petition by ordering that bail granted to petitioner Bijendra Prasad Yadav shall continue for the duration of the case on the same terms and conditions, discontinuing the previous practice of extending bail every six months. The Court reserved the right for C.B.I. to apply for bail cancellation and clarified that deliberate trial protraction or unnecessary adjournments would constitute grounds for cancellation.
